The confusion often happens because Forest is a common noun, while Forrest is usually a person’s name or surname. You might see Forrest Gump, but when talking about trees, wildlife, or nature, the correct word is forest.

Forest or Forrest – Quick Answer

✅ Direct Answer

👉 Forest = The correct spelling for a large area filled with trees.

👉 Forrest = Usually a first name or last name, not the common noun for woods.

What Does Forest or Forrest Mean?

Forest

A forest is a large area covered with many trees, plants, and wildlife.

It can also refer to protected natural land, national forests, or rainforests.

Forrest

Forrest is mainly used as a personal name or family name.

It is not the standard spelling for woodland.

The Origin of Forest or Forrest

The word forest comes from Old French forest, meaning land covered with trees and reserved for hunting.

Over time, it became the standard English spelling.

The spelling Forrest developed as a surname and later became a given name. Today, it is most recognized through names like Forrest Gump.

How to Pronounce Forest or Forrest

Both words are pronounced almost exactly the same.

Pronunciation

FOR-ist

Phonetic:

/ˈfɒrɪst/ (UK)

/ˈfɔːrɪst/ (US)

Easy Trick

Say:

FOR + ist

The pronunciation does not change even though Forrest has an extra “r.”
